Senate Bill 910; Regular Session 2009-2010

[History]

Printer's No.(PN):
Short Title:
An Act amending the act of February 1, 1966 (1965 P.L.1656, No.581), known as The Borough Code, as to civil service for police and firemen, further providing for general provisions relating to examinations, for rejection of applicant and hearing, for manner of filling appointments, for probationary period, for physical examination and for promotions.
